在软件开发和文档编写中,确保文本的准确性至关重要,尤其是对于开发者而言。错误的拼写不仅影响了可读性,还可能导致误解。为了提高文本的质量,错别字检查成为了一项重要的任务。本文将详细探讨如何在GitHub上进行错别字检查,提供有效的工具和方法。
错别字检查的重要性
在开发过程中,文档和注释的质量直接影响团队的效率。以下是错别字检查的重要性:
- 提升可读性:清晰、准确的文档有助于团队成员快速理解代码。
- 减少误解:拼写错误可能导致技术上的误解,影响项目的进展。
- 提升专业形象:良好的文档质量能够提升团队或公司的专业形象。
GitHub上可用的错别字检查工具
在GitHub上,有多个工具可以帮助我们进行错别字检查,以下是一些推荐:
1. Spellcheck GitHub Action
-
描述:这是一个自动化的工具,可以在每次提交或拉取请求时检查文本中的拼写错误。
-
安装方法:在项目的
workflow
文件中添加以下代码: yaml name: Spell Check on: [push, pull_request] jobs: spellcheck: runs-on: ubuntu-latest steps: – name: Checkout code uses: actions/checkout@v2 – name: Run spellcheck uses: mfractor/spellcheck-action@v2 -
优点:集成简单,实时检测。
2. write-good GitHub Action
-
描述:这个工具主要用于检测文档中的拼写和语法错误。
-
安装方法:同样在
workflow
文件中添加相关代码: yaml name: Write Good on: [push, pull_request] jobs: write-good: runs-on: ubuntu-latest steps: – name: Checkout code uses: actions/checkout@v2 – name: Run write-good uses: brianwalters/write-good-action@v1 -
优点:不仅检查拼写,还提供风格建议。
使用错别字检查工具的最佳实践
在使用这些工具时,有一些最佳实践需要遵循:
- 定期检查:确保每次提交代码前都进行拼写检查。
- 自定义字典:根据项目需求,自定义字典,避免误报。
- 结合代码审核:在代码审核中,增加对文档和注释的检查。
常见问题解答
错别字检查工具可以检测哪些语言的拼写?
大多数错别字检查工具支持多种语言,包括中文、英文等,但具体支持的语言取决于使用的工具。在使用前,建议查看工具的文档以确认支持的语言。
如何处理拼写检查的误报?
在使用错别字检查工具时,可能会出现误报的情况。这时可以:
- 自定义字典:将误报的单词加入到自定义字典中。
- 调整工具设置:根据项目的具体需求,调整检查的规则。
在GitHub中如何查看拼写检查的结果?
拼写检查的结果通常会在Pull Request页面中以评论的形式显示,用户可以根据提示进行相应的修改。
是否可以将错别字检查集成到现有的CI/CD流程中?
是的,错别字检查可以通过GitHub Actions轻松集成到现有的CI/CD流程中,确保在每次部署前都进行文本检查。
总结
错别字检查是提升GitHub项目质量的重要环节。通过利用各种工具和遵循最佳实践,开发者能够显著提高代码和文档的可读性与专业性。希望本文能够帮助您在GitHub上有效地进行错别字检查,推动项目的顺利进行。